From: Distribution of sources of household air pollution: a cross-sectional study in Cameroon
Targeted Health Areas of the study | Urban or Rural | Population size in 2018 (inhabitants) | Clusters (Reached/Expected) | Households reached |
---|---|---|---|---|
Fiala-Foreke (1) | Urban | 34,760 | 20/20 | 197 |
Balevouni (2) | Rural | 1856 | 1/1 | 12 |
Nkeuli (3) | Rural | 2691 | 2/2 | 19 |
Fotetsa (4) | Rural | 5128 | 3/3 | 28 |
Maka (5) | Urban | 10,804 | 6/6 | 60 |
Fonakeukeu (6) | Rural | 5149 | 3/3 | 30 |
Lepoh (7) | Rural | 10,472 | 6/6 | 60 |
Ndoh-Djuttitsa (8) | Rural | 13,663 | 9/9 | 93 |
Baleveng (9) | Rural | 20,658 | 12/12 | 118 |
Doumbouo (10) | Rural | 16,908 | 10/10 | 99 |
Mbeng (11) | Rural | 20,508 | 13/13 | 132 |
TOTAL | / | 142,597 | 85/85 | 848 |
